You might have heard that the Chinese use minced green onion recipes a lot in their cooking. Also, you might be thinking that spring onion, green onion and scallions are the same. Even though they look somewhat similar there is a slight difference between one variant and the other. For instance, among these three variants, scallions have the thinnest stem, while green onions have slightly larger stems. When you take the case of spring onions, they look round. Chinese use all these three variants in their cooking frequently. They prepare Chinese minced green onion recipes in their homes because they know that they are rich in vitamin K and C.
When you wish to prepare easy minced green onion recipes in your home, first, you will have to mince the green onions into tiny pieces. If you have the right tool in your home for mincing them, you can use the tool. Otherwise, you will have to cut them into fine pieces. When you intend to make the best minced green onion recipes, make sure that you do not keep the minced onion open for long. The reason is that they can attract impurities from the environment. So, use them in your dish immediately after mincing them.
